Torre del Greco: Coast Guard raid: 40 items seized on public beaches

Beach spots "reserved" with umbrellas, chairs, and tables left unattended: in Torre del Greco, the Coast Guard intervened, seizing 40 pieces of beach equipment abandoned on the public beach.

The operation was conducted by the Port Authority – Coast Guard of Torre del Greco as part of the "Sea and Lakes Safe 2026" campaign, coordinated by the Campania Maritime Directorate, with the aim of strengthening controls on state-owned maritime property and navigation safety.

The checks focused in particular on the "laghetti" area, where Coast Guard personnel, with the support of the Municipal Police, confirmed the presence of numerous objects left on the free beach to permanently occupy the space and secure a spot upon return.

The measure followed several complaints from tourists and beachgoers, who reported the improper occupation of large portions of the beach with umbrellas, deckchairs, and other equipment left unattended for days.

During the intervention, 40 umbrellas, beach chairs, and other materials were removed and seized. The affected areas were thus returned to free use by residents and visitors.

The Coast Guard reminds you that the municipal regulations for the management of public maritime property expressly prohibit leaving umbrellas, tents, deck chairs, or any other beach equipment on public beaches after sunset.

This initiative is part of a broader plan to combat illegal activities on public maritime property, carried out by the Coast Guard, together with law enforcement and local institutions, with the aim of ensuring everyone's right to use the sea and beaches correctly and safely.

For emergencies at sea, the Blue Number 1530 remains active, in addition to the operations room of the Torre del Greco Harbour Master's Office, which can be reached at 081 8812200.
